NPFC - MIL-S-4040
SOLENOID, ELECTRICAL, GENERAL SPECIFICATION FOR
| Organization: | NPFC |
| Publication Date: | 23 January 1969 |
| Status: | inactive |
| Page Count: | 21 |
scope:
This specification covers the general requirements for electrical solenoids used to actuate various devices through the conversion of electrical signals into mechanical motion. These solenoids are of the axial stroke type in which the mechanical force is direct movement in a plane parallel to the longitudinal axis of the coil, and the rotary stroke type.
Solenoids are classified as follows:
SYMBOL TYPE DUTY ROTATION I Pull Continuous - II Pull Intermittent - III Push Continuous - IV Push Intermittent - V Rotary Continuous Clockwise VI Rotary Intermittent Clockwise VII Rotary Continuous Counterclockwise VIII Rotary Intermittent Counterclockwise
